UTILITY SERVICES
Since February 1, 2019, we have been providing freshwater supply and sewerage collection and disposal services to the island of K. Dhiffushi. On July 14, 2020, Altec Maldives Pvt. Ltd. received a permanent license for Utility Operations of Water and Sewerage Services from the Environment Protection Agency (EPA).
Our water system features over 7 km of underground pipelines serving approximately 350 customers. To ensure a quality and uninterrupted water supply, we operate three RO plants with a combined capacity exceeding 350 cbm/day, compliant with the standards set by the Utility Regulatory Authority of Maldives (URA). For reserve water storage, we maintain two tanks, each with a capacity of 800 m³.
Our sewer network comprises more than 7 km of underground pipelines, 300 manholes, and four collection pumping stations, along with one disposal pump station.
To ensure efficient water and sewer operations, we established a dedicated utility operations department within our company headquarters and at our branch office in K. Dhiffushi. A laboratory was also set up, equipped with the necessary tools for testing. Customers can conveniently pay their utility bills for water and sewerage services at the branch office. Since our commencement, we have provided uninterrupted potable drinking water while consistently maintaining the quality standards established by the Utility Regulatory Authority (URA).
